Abstract
⺠The SNc and mPFC regulate the firing activity of GABA interneurons in the DRN. ⺠8-OH-DPAT (i.v.) produced in three types of effects in the interneurons of rats with sham lesions of the SNc. ⺠8-OH-DPAT (i.v.) inhibited all interneurons in rats with lesions of the SNc, mPFC and the paired lesions. ⺠mPFC lesion increased response of the interneurons to 8-OH-DPAT, whereas the SNc lesion decreased it. ⺠SNc lesion decreased the percentage of PV-5-HT1A co-expressing neurons in the DRVL.
